Output 38f86810cd065528bbe4078d376e08e6b268077d412072ec3aed08b44b0178d9:7

value
309262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d53bf42fbfa6f4eea8afd3215183febee272f527 OP_EQUAL
address
3M8Vg537P3EyEBuLfZaWjHUfh8Ht18WNcZ
transaction
38f86810cd065528bbe4078d376e08e6b268077d412072ec3aed08b44b0178d9
spent
true